如何上传同一文件到两台不同的机器上?

时间:2022-09-14 21:00:01
我使用ASP.NET,C#编写,现在程序放在两台计算机上,用同一个ip访问。我想上传一个文件到这两台服务器上,请问如何实现?

10 个解决方案

#1


你两台服务器能用一个IP吗,还是说对外是一个IP?

另机器名不同,你可以依次上传到每个机器的相应目录下

#2


你两台服务器能用一个IP吗

关注
程序中直接写就是了

#3


不明白
帮顶

#4


是对外用一个ip来访问,比如:两台服务器ip分别为192.168.100.18,192.168.100.19,程序放在这两个服务器上,但是外部访问的话,用192.168.100.20来访问,通过动态(负载平衡)来设置是调用那个服务器上的程序。现在用户希望做一个能上传文件的功能,但是现在只能上传到一个服务器上,也就是打开网页的那台机器。另外一个服务器并没有更新。请大家帮忙!分不够再加!

#5


用户上传到一个上时,复制到另外一个不行吗?

#6


如何实现复制呢? freecs(北狼) 可否说明白一些?

#7


freecs(北狼) ,能粘代码妈?

#8


你说物理复制?不行,客户不能直接访问服务器的.

#9


上传文件无非是用
PostedFile.SaveAs(filepath);

你可以把一台机器的目录共享到另外一台,然后再调用以上命令的时候同时保存到本机目录和共享目录不久行了。。

#10


在另一台服务器上做一个Web服务,同时调用这个Web服务来更新另一台服务器上的程序。

#1


你两台服务器能用一个IP吗,还是说对外是一个IP?

另机器名不同,你可以依次上传到每个机器的相应目录下

#2


你两台服务器能用一个IP吗

关注
程序中直接写就是了

#3


不明白
帮顶

#4


是对外用一个ip来访问,比如:两台服务器ip分别为192.168.100.18,192.168.100.19,程序放在这两个服务器上,但是外部访问的话,用192.168.100.20来访问,通过动态(负载平衡)来设置是调用那个服务器上的程序。现在用户希望做一个能上传文件的功能,但是现在只能上传到一个服务器上,也就是打开网页的那台机器。另外一个服务器并没有更新。请大家帮忙!分不够再加!

#5


用户上传到一个上时,复制到另外一个不行吗?

#6


如何实现复制呢? freecs(北狼) 可否说明白一些?

#7


freecs(北狼) ,能粘代码妈?

#8


你说物理复制?不行,客户不能直接访问服务器的.

#9


上传文件无非是用
PostedFile.SaveAs(filepath);

你可以把一台机器的目录共享到另外一台,然后再调用以上命令的时候同时保存到本机目录和共享目录不久行了。。

#10


在另一台服务器上做一个Web服务,同时调用这个Web服务来更新另一台服务器上的程序。